A leading educational organization in the United Kingdom is seeking a responsible and motivated PPA Cover Teacher to support teaching staff by delivering lessons during planning time. The ideal candidate should hold Qualified Teacher Status and possess experience in a UK primary school, showcasing confident classroom management skills. This role offers a dynamic opportunity to work across various primary schools, ensuring a positive learning environment for pupils when the class teacher is unavailable.

How to prepare for a job interview at TailorEducation

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you’re familiar with the UK primary education system and the specific curriculum. Brush up on your subject knowledge and be ready to discuss how you would approach lesson delivery during a teacher's planning time.

Showcase Your Classroom Management Skills

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ed a classroom in the past. Think about specific strategies you’ve used to engage students and maintain a positive learning environment, as this will be crucial for the role.

Be Ready for Scenario Questions

Expect questions that put you in hypothetical situations, like handling disruptive behaviour or adapting lessons for different learning needs. Practise your responses to these scenarios to demonstrate your problem-solving skills and adaptability.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ions ready about the school’s culture, support for supply teachers, or professional development opportunities.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
